Get PriceSulfuric acid leaching circuits commonly employ either manganese dioxide or chlorate ion to oxidize the tetravalent uranium ion U 4 to the hexavalent uranyl ion UO 22 Typically about 5 kilograms 11 pounds of manganese dioxide or kilograms of sodium chlorate per ton suffice to oxidize tetravalent uranium

Get PriceThe recycled anolyte contained manganese sulfate and ammonium sulfate After leaching the ore the manganese sulfate content and impurities in the cyclic leach liquor had been increased by the additional manganese extraction The impurities were essentially iron in the form of ferric sulfate plus a small amount of ferrous sulfate
